首页 > 科技 >

断一个数是否为素数 🧮🔍

发布时间:2025-03-08 01:30:14来源:

素数是数学中的基本概念之一,它指的是只能被1和自身整除的大于1的自然数。例如,2、3、5、7等都是素数。判断一个数是否为素数的方法多种多样,接下来我们就来探讨几种常见的方法吧!🚀

首先,最基本的方法是试除法。通过尝试用小于该数的所有自然数去除这个数,如果都不能整除,则说明这个数是素数。这种方法虽然简单,但效率较低,特别是对于较大的数来说,计算量会非常大。👩‍💻

其次,可以利用素数的性质进行优化。比如,如果一个数不是素数,那么它至少有一个不大于其平方根的因子。因此,在进行试除时,只需检查到该数的平方根即可。这样一来,就能大大减少计算量,提高效率。💡

此外,还有更高级的算法如米勒-拉宾素性测试等,适用于大规模的数,这里就不做详细介绍了。不过,对于普通大小的数来说,上述方法已经足够使用了。🌟

掌握这些方法后,判断一个数是否为素数就不再是难题啦!试着找几个数来练习一下吧,你会发现其中的乐趣所在。📚🧮

素数 数学游戏 编程挑战

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。